Cult series The Munsters getting television remake treatment

Pushing Daisies creator Bryan Fuller is developing a modern-day reboot of the creepshow classic The Munsters, according to EW. The new show is expected to run on NBC, which has only ordered a pilot thus far. The potential series is being described as “Modern Family meets True Blood,” and rumor has it that Guillermo del ….

Guillermo Del Toro joins guest list of Fangoria fest in NYC

Fangoria announced today that superstar director/producer/writer Guillermo Del Toro has joined the guest list headlining the upcoming Fangoria Weekend Of Horrors, which is slashing its way back into New York City on June 5 to 7, 2009 at the Jacob Javits Convention Center. Guillermo’s incredible work includes directing Hellboy I & II, Pan’s Labyrinth, Blade ….
